Output f63c0c26a6499ae65d0de32f8523582a3a9140152cdf97205ea26164e2fc4772:3

value
392739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ca3b7c72b6ccd46d9f5ac96dee92a96fe59a758 OP_EQUAL
address
3A8rDWY9M7CTyJ4fms4UJFQvhWb3Fek63A
transaction
f63c0c26a6499ae65d0de32f8523582a3a9140152cdf97205ea26164e2fc4772
confirmations
282987
spent
true